About

Nanci S. Kane is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Aging. According to data from OpenAlex, Nanci S. Kane has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 324 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 3 papers in Aging. Recurrent topics in Nanci S. Kane’s work include Genetics, Aging, and Longevity in Model Organisms (3 papers), Neurobiology and Insect Physiology Research (3 papers) and Insect symbiosis and bacterial influences (2 papers). Nanci S. Kane is often cited by papers focused on Genetics, Aging, and Longevity in Model Organisms (3 papers), Neurobiology and Insect Physiology Research (3 papers) and Insect symbiosis and bacterial influences (2 papers). Nanci S. Kane collaborates with scholars based in United States and China. Nanci S. Kane's co-authors include Alain Robichon, Ralph J. Greenspan, Mehul Vora, Richard W. Padgett, McHardy M. Smith, David Hunt, Yingcong Zheng, Birgit Hirschberg, Richard M. Brochu and Steven W. Ludmerer and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Neuron and Nature Communications.
